
java
文章平均质量分 60
iteye_10700
这个作者很懒,什么都没留下…
展开
-
[转]JDBC使用TNS连接多节点Oracle
JDBC使用TNS连接多节点Oracle 为了使用tns方式连接,只需要写出tns连接的rul即可,tns连接的url写法如下: -- 未加注释的TNS连接串 jdbc:oracle:thin:@ (description= (ADDRESS_LIST = (address=(protocol=tcp)(host=192.168.1.44)(port...原创 2012-06-29 15:15:27 · 181 阅读 · 0 评论 -
转 说说Java中的枚举(一)
转自 〖 作者:中华风筝 〗http://www.java3z.com 在实际编程中,往往存在着这样的“数据集”,它们的数值在程序中是稳定的,而且“数据集”中的元素是有限的。例如星期一到星期日七个数据元素组成了一周的“数据集”,春夏秋冬四个数据元素组成了四季的“数据集”。在Java中想表示这种数据集最容易想到的写法可能是这样,我们以表示一周五天的工作日来举例: Java代码...原创 2010-08-06 18:18:13 · 172 阅读 · 0 评论 -
ant 安装配置小结
1、Ant包下载地址:http://ant.apache.org/bindownload.cgi2、解压缩整个包3、在你想放置的位置建一个目录,比如D:\Ant4、将解压缩得到的/lib和/bin两个目录整个拷贝到之前建好的D:\Ant下5、在环境变量中设置 ANT_HOME = D:\Ant6、在环境变量的CLASSPATH及Path中添加:%ANT_HOME%\bin7...原创 2011-01-20 10:48:36 · 181 阅读 · 0 评论 -
jbpm
http://java.chinaitlab.com/JBoss/784873_4.htmlhttp://blog.youkuaiyun.com/yanyouning/archive/2006/07/22/959999.aspxhttp://www.360doc.com/content/07/0712/19/33920_607704.shtml原创 2010-07-22 16:41:37 · 81 阅读 · 0 评论 -
JSP页面用get传递参数乱码问题
通过get 方式传递参数时,如果参数是中文 ,则会出现乱码现在,这是因为Ie在在解析这些参数值时是通过iso8859-1编码方法进行的,所以,中文会出现乱码.解决方法:1. 对传递的值进行编码,也是比较简单的一种方法,缺点是编码方法在程序中写死了,不利于以后修改:String name=new String(request.getParameter("name").getBytes("...原创 2011-06-24 15:52:07 · 121 阅读 · 0 评论 -
[174 javajni.c] [error] 找不到指定的模块
今天重装系统,装了最新的JDK1.6和tomcat6.0结果配置好环境变量。启动居然不能正常进行。进LOG看了一下错误如下:-------------------------------------TOMCAT日志------------------------------[2008-01-28 13:28:27] [info] Procrun (2.0.3.0) started[2...2010-04-05 23:58:01 · 361 阅读 · 0 评论 -
转 java内存泄漏
Java内存泄漏是每个Java程序员都会遇到的问题,程序在本地运行一切正常,可是布署到远端就会出现内存无限制的增长,最后系统瘫痪,那么如何最快最好的检测程序的稳定性,防止系统崩盘,作者用自已的亲身经历与各位网友分享解决这些问题的办法。 作为Internet最流行的编程语言之一,Java现正非常流行。我们的网络应用程序就主要采用Java语言开发,大体上分为客户端、服务器和数据库三个层次。在进入...2010-04-05 15:39:08 · 91 阅读 · 0 评论 -
myeclipse设置tomcat启动方式
1.MYeclipse有RUN模式和DEBUG模式在MYeclipse的 window中preferences->myeclipse enterprise workbench->Servers ->tomcat->tomcat6.0->launch->tomcat launch mode选择debug mode 或者 run mode方式...2010-04-01 01:44:44 · 238 阅读 · 0 评论 -
JDBC SQLSERVER"Error establishing socket"
出现错误:Cannot create PoolableConnectionFactory ([Microsoft][SQLServer 2000 Driver for JDBC]Error establishing socket.) 按下面这些方法都试了: jdbc配置语句为: jdbc:microsoft:sqlserver://server_name:1433 如运行程序时...2010-03-19 12:24:07 · 99 阅读 · 0 评论 -
转 整理Java项目命名规范
查了Java项目命名规范 sun 在线文档 帮助文档。 下面转自 :Trackback: http://tb.blog.youkuaiyun.com/TrackBack.aspx?PostId=1443852级别I: 默认登记要求所有项目中的所有成员遵守。 级别II: 建议所有项目中的所有成员遵守。 级别III: 鼓励各个项目根据实际情况执行。 使用T...2010-03-19 04:22:33 · 274 阅读 · 0 评论 -
eclipse快捷键
Tab 使选中的代码向右Shift +Tab 使选中的代码向左 Ctrl + I 更正缩进的快捷键Ctrl+1 快速修复(最经典的快捷键,就不用多说了)Ctrl+D: 删除当前行Ctrl+Alt+↓ 复制当前行到下一行(复制增加)Ctrl+Alt+↑ 复制当前行到上一行(复制增加)Alt+↓ 当前行和下面一行交互位置(特别实用,可以省去先剪切,再粘贴了)Alt+↑ 当前行和上...2010-03-13 05:08:30 · 78 阅读 · 0 评论 -
reference
今天看《Thinking in java》4th发现 //: initialization/InitialValues.java// Shows default initial values.import static net.mindview.util.Print.*;public class InitialValues { boolean t; char c; byte b...2010-03-12 12:17:14 · 83 阅读 · 0 评论 -
转贴 信息系统建模方法
作者:周中元http://web.tongji.edu.cn/~yangdy/research.html---- 大型信息系统通常十分复杂,很难直接对它进行分析设计,人们经常借助模型来设计分析系统。模型是现实世界中的某些事物的一种抽象表示。抽象的含义是抽取事物的本质特性,忽略事物的其他次要因素。因此,模型既反映事物的原型,又不等于该原型。模型是理解、分析、开发或改造事物原型的一种常用手段...2010-03-10 09:25:40 · 175 阅读 · 0 评论 -
Cannot load JDBC driver class 'com.microsoft.sqlserver.jdbc.SQLServerDriver'
用得tomcat6.0配置数据库连接池缺少msbase.jar,mssqlserver.jar,msutil.jar并在tomcat的lib下加入上文件和WebRoot\WEB-INF\lib下加入上文件 dbcp连接池程序包,要在同一目录下即web-inf/lib下 SQL Server2000的JDBC驱动程序的DriverClassNam...原创 2010-03-05 06:02:15 · 550 阅读 · 0 评论 -
java连接数据库方言
https://www.hibernate.org/hib_docs/v3/api/org/hibernate/dialect/package-summary.html#package_description2010-03-02 13:53:10 · 460 阅读 · 0 评论 -
Class 'org.springframework.jdbc.datasource.DriverManagerDataSource' not foun
上面的错缺少*sping-jdbc*.jar2010-03-02 13:29:13 · 925 阅读 · 0 评论 -
ExtJs 学习笔记 之2
Ext2.0对框架进行了非常大的重构,其中最重要的是形成了一个结构及层次分明的组件体系,由这些组件形成了Ext控件。Ext组件由Component类定义,每一种组件都有一个指定的xtype属性值,通过该值可以得到一个组件的类型或者是定义一个指定类型的组件。 Ext组件体系由下图所示: 组件大致可分成三大类,即基本组件、工具栏组件、表单元素组件。基本组件有 这么多的组件,可都是非常酷的。...2010-02-22 08:24:19 · 91 阅读 · 0 评论 -
转 说说Java中的枚举(二)
转自 http://www.java3z.com 〖 作者:中华风筝 〗到目前为止,我们仅仅使用了最简单的语法定义枚举类型,其实枚举类型可以做更多的事情,在Tiger的定义中,枚举是一种新的类型,允许用常量来表示特定的数据片断,它能胜任普通类的大部分功能,如定义自己的构造函数、方法、属性等等。这也是Java与C/C++或是Pascal中不同的地方,在那两种语言中枚举类型代表的就是一些...原创 2010-08-06 18:23:59 · 123 阅读 · 0 评论 -
[转]HTTP1.1和HTTP1.0的区别
HTTP1.1和HTTP1.0的区别作者:千里孤行(http://blog.youkuaiyun.com/yanghehong)翻了下HTTP1.1的协议标准RFC2616 http://www.ietf.org/rfc/rfc2616.txt,下面是看到的一些它跟HTTP1.0的差别。 Persistent Connection(持久连接) 在HTTP1.0中,每对Request/R...原创 2011-02-14 16:23:56 · 95 阅读 · 0 评论 -
eclipse-jee-galileo-win32使用总结
一:Eclipse jee的web项目部署路径 eclipse jee把web工程部署到\.metadata\.plugins\org.eclipse.wst.server.core\tmp0\wtpwebapps\下去了 二:如何创建Dynamic Web Project项目(这块转载于http://www.360doc.com) 我们推荐使用解压版的tomcat6.x...原创 2011-02-18 17:10:46 · 167 阅读 · 0 评论 -
Java调用BCP导入数据到数据库解决标识列ID问题
面的一篇博文讲解了调用bcp批量导出数据,对于批量导入数据则写的不怎么详细,本文再详细的介绍下一个使用技巧。对于批量导入,如果表中含有标识列,则默认会按照Sql Server 的处理方式来处理这个标识列,因此也就不是我们需要的ID值了,本文我们一起来探讨下解决方法。。①要导入的数据如下: 红框框的则是标识列,自动增长。但是,我们使用了 bcp sportSys...原创 2012-06-29 14:53:27 · 278 阅读 · 0 评论 -
java 可变参数方法Object... objs
public abstract List find(String hql, Object... values); Object... values,你也可以认为是Object[]values,数组. 可变参数(Varargs) 可变参数使程序员可以声明一个接受可变数目参数的方法。注意,可变参数必须是 函数声明中的最后一个参数。假设我们要写一个简单的方法打印一些对象, uti...原创 2012-06-29 14:42:46 · 1588 阅读 · 0 评论 -
WIN7环境下cmd javac不是内部或外部命令 .
一般步骤如下:网上摘抄部分: JAVA_HOME指明JAVA安装路径,值设为:C:\Program Files\Java\jre7(刚才安装时所选择的路径,每个人可能不一样),此路径下包括lib,bin,jre等文件夹; Path值设为: %JAVA_HOME%\bin;%JAVA_HOME%\jre\bin CLASSPATH值设为:.;%JAVA_HOME%\l...原创 2015-07-21 11:27:58 · 193 阅读 · 0 评论 -
驱动程序无法通过使用安全套接字层(SSL)加密与 SQL Server 建立安全连接 错误解决办法 ...
用java连接sqlserver2005时总是出现下面这个错误June 13, 2012 10:05:34 AM com.microsoft.sqlserver.jdbc.TDSChannel enableSSL信息: java.security path: C:\Java\jre6\lib\securitySecurity providers: [SUN version 1....原创 2012-06-13 12:56:53 · 888 阅读 · 0 评论 -
javac编译外部jar包
这个有个很简单到解决办法,不过我也是尝试了很多方法,然后发现这个最好! 1. 找到安装jre目录的文件夹,我用到是ubuntu10.10,有些人用windows的也是一样到。例如,我的是在:/usr/lib/jvm/java-6-openjdk/jre/注意:ubuntu安装java jdk的时候,默认是安装到上面所示到那个文件夹里面到。2. 然后找到jre目录下到...原创 2012-06-12 14:23:45 · 390 阅读 · 0 评论 -
[转]Eclipse中将Java项目(引用了第三方包) 打包为jar
如果自己的java project中需要引用额外的jar包作为资源文件,那么需要自定义配置文件MANIFEST.MF ,例如:Manifest-Version: 1.0Class-Path: lib\crimson.jar lib\jbcl.jar lib\junit.jar lib\log4j-1.2.13.jar lib\mysql-connector-java-3.1.13-bin....原创 2012-06-12 14:13:09 · 105 阅读 · 0 评论 -
[转]jdk和jre有什么区别?
来源简单的说JDK是面向开发人员使用的SDK,它提供了Java的开发环境和运行环境。SDK是Software Development Kit 一般指软件开发包,可以包括函数库、编译程序等。 JDK就是Java Development Kit JRE是Java Runtime Enviroment是指Java的运行环境,是面向Java程序的使用者,而不是开发者。 如果安装了JDK,会发同你的电脑...原创 2012-03-09 14:28:43 · 128 阅读 · 0 评论 -
[转]Java线程:线程栈模型与线程的变量
Java线程:线程栈模型与线程的变量 SCJP5学习笔记 要理解线程调度的原理,以及线程执行过程,必须理解线程栈模型。线程栈是指某时刻时内存中线程调度的栈信息,当前调用的方法总是位于栈顶。线程栈的内容是随着程序的运行动态变化的,因此研究线程栈必须选择一个运行的时刻(实际上指代码运行到什么地方)。 下面通过一个示例性的代码说明线程(调用)栈的变化过程。 ...原创 2012-02-16 14:06:02 · 90 阅读 · 0 评论 -
[转] Java线程:概念与原理
Java线程:概念与原理 SCJP5学习笔记 一、操作系统中线程和进程的概念现在的操作系统是多任务操作系统。多线程是实现多任务的一种方式。进程是指一个内存中运行的应用程序,每个进程都有自己独立的一块内存空间,一个进程中可以启动多个线程。比如在Windows系统中,一个运行的exe就是一个进程。 线程是指进程中的一个执行流程,一个进程中可以运行多个线程。比...原创 2012-02-16 13:29:00 · 141 阅读 · 0 评论 -
Java线程:创建与启动
SCJP5学习笔记 一、定义线程 1、扩展java.lang.Thread类。 此类中有个run()方法,应该注意其用法:public void run()如果该线程是使用独立的 Runnable 运行对象构造的,则调用该 Runnable 对象的 run 方法;否则,该方法不执行任何操作并返回。 Thread 的子类应该重写该...原创 2012-02-16 13:26:16 · 92 阅读 · 0 评论 -
Spring框架下资源属性的配置器类PropertyPlaceholderConfigurer
在applicationContext.xml里配置DBCP数据链接池时,dbcp.propertiesdbcp.driverClassName = com.microsoft.sqlserver.jdbc.SQLServerDriverdbcp.url = jdbc:sqlserver://192.168.1.132:1433;DatabaseName=HotelDBdbcp....原创 2011-02-25 15:01:33 · 180 阅读 · 0 评论 -
[转]DBCP连接池:原理与基本配置
转于大约在半年前,曾经帮同事解决过一个Commons-dbcp连接池的问题。当时遇到的问题比较诡异,但是其实并不是什么特别复杂的问题,了解DBCP的原理,大部分问题就迎刃而解了。本文主要对连接池的基本原理以及dbcp的实现方式做一个分析,对dbcp的配置参数结合原理做一个简单解释。连接池扼要JDBC是一套通用的Java语言与多种数据库(文件)通讯的标准API。大部分针对数据库服务器...原创 2011-02-23 16:50:02 · 103 阅读 · 0 评论 -
DBCP数据库连接池
dbcp连接池jar包下载地址 http://commons.apache.org/dbcp/download_dbcp.cgi 将commons-dbcp和commons-pool两个JAR包拷LIB里面, 在struts里配置: <struts-config> <data-sources> <data-sourc...原创 2011-02-23 16:43:42 · 148 阅读 · 0 评论 -
[转]配置Spring数据源c3p0与dbcp
不管通过何种持久化技术,都必须通过数据连接访问数据库,在Spring中,数据连接是通过数据源获得的。在以往的应用中,数据源一般是 Web应用服务器提供的。在Spring中,你不但可以通过JNDI获取应用服务器的数据源,也可以直接在Spring容器中配置数据源,此外,你还可以通过代码的方式创建一个数据源,以便进行无依赖的单元测试配置一个数据源 Spring在第三方依赖包中包含了两个数据源的实...原创 2011-02-23 15:11:25 · 127 阅读 · 0 评论 -
log4j.properties配置详解
以下内容从Google和baidu上搜到出来的,关于log4j.properties的详细配置. Log4J的配置文件(Configuration File)就是用来设置记录器的级别、存放器和布局的,它可接key=value格式的设置或xml格式的设置信息。通过配置,可以创建出Log4J的运行环境。 1. 配置文件Log4J配置文件的基本格式如下: #配置根Loggerl...原创 2011-02-23 00:26:41 · 97 阅读 · 0 评论 -
spring入门 错误
1:org.springframework.beans.factory.CannotLoadBeanClassException: Cannot find class [com.mchange.v2.c3p0.ComboPooledDataSource] for bean with name 'dataSource' defined in ServletContext resource [/WEB...原创 2011-02-18 17:22:40 · 108 阅读 · 0 评论 -
什么是ext组件 ext学习笔记1
软件行业中--ext 是 ExtJs的简称,是一个强大的js类库。主要包括data,widget,form,gird,dd,menu,其中最强大的应该算gird了,编程思想是基于面对对象编程(oop),扩展性相当的好.可以自己写扩展.自己定义命名空间.web应用可能感觉太大.不过您可以根据需要按需加载您想要的类库就可以了. 主要包括三个大的文件ext-all.css,ext-base....原创 2010-02-22 06:47:23 · 152 阅读 · 0 评论 -
转 Myeclipse 单步调试 详释
最基本的操作是: 1, 首先在一个java文件中设断点,然后运行,当程序走到断点处就会转到debug视图下, 2, F5键与F6键均为单步调试,F5是step into,也就是进入本行代码中执行,F6是step over, 也就是执行本行代码,跳到下一行,3,F7是跳出函数 step return 4,F8是执行到最后。 ===================================== ...原创 2010-02-01 02:34:27 · 188 阅读 · 0 评论 -
转 奉继承博士:浅析深究什么是云计算
云计算现在是IT界热得发烫的词汇。从美利坚到英吉利,从长城内外到大江南北,到处是彩云飘飘。 有人认为云计算是计算机发展的未来,是革命性的变化,所谓计算就象水和电一样,打开开关或者拧开水龙头就OK。多么美妙的世界! 但也有人对云计算嗤之以鼻,认为这是业界的概念炒作,无非是希望在互联网时代,让大型主机获得新生的商业手段,或者认为是.Com公司创造的新的话题。 究竟什么是云计算,它对...原创 2010-01-27 10:47:31 · 159 阅读 · 0 评论 -
final long serialVersionUID
import java.util.Set; import com.opensymphony.xwork2.ActionSupport; public class ChatAction extends ActionSupport { private static final long serialVersionUID = 8445871212065L ; ...2009-12-23 11:38:37 · 199 阅读 · 0 评论